Click here for Answers speed, distance, time Practice Questions Previous Pressure Practice Questions Next … WebMar 31, 2024 · To calculate speed, distance and time, you need to remember three key formulas. These are: Speed = Distance/Time (commonly shortened to s = d/t s = d/t) Distance = Speed x Time (commonly shortened to d = s \times t d = s × t) Time = Distance/Speed (commonly shortened to t = d/s t = d/s) WebFeb 27, 2024 · Questions related to speed, distance and time include various categories such as straight line, relative motion, circular motion, trains, boats, clocks, races, etc. What are Speed, Time and Distance?
